How it works
Protein scales with body weight (1.6–2.2 g/kg depending on goal). Fat sits at 20–30% of calories. Carbs fill the remaining calories: (total kcal − protein kcal − fat kcal) ÷ 4. Each gram of protein and carbs = 4 kcal; each gram of fat = 9 kcal.
Frequently asked
- How much protein should I eat per day?
- For most active adults, 1.6–2.2 g per kg of body weight. Higher end if cutting or training hard for muscle, lower end if sedentary.
- What ratio of carbs to fat is best?
- Both are valid fuels. Most lifters do well with 40–50% carbs, 25–30% fat. Lower-carb diets bump fat higher; endurance athletes push carbs higher.
- Do macros really matter or just calories?
- Calories drive weight change; macros drive body composition. Eating enough protein while in a deficit preserves muscle, which is the main reason people track macros.
